Mit der Skriptsprache PHP können Programmierer erstellen erhebliche Websites und Anwendungen . Je nach Art und Umfang eines Projekts , Programmierer manchmal teilen den Entwicklungsprozess in mehrere Phasen . Diese Phasen beginnen mit der Planung und Gestaltung der Applikation oder Website von einer abstrakten Perspektive , vor der Implementierung in PHP -Code. Nachdem die Entwickler haben die Umsetzungsphase durchgeführt , sie können aber auch in Tests vor der Auslieferung zu engagieren das Endergebnis. Planung
Bevor Codierung beginnt , Entwickler oft eingreifen in die Einsatzplanung . Die Komplexität dieser Phase hängt vom Projekt ab , aber es in der Regel findet ein Prozess der Festlegung der Anforderungen der Anwendung definiert diese mit einer Art der Dokumentation. Die Planung ist im Grunde eine Möglichkeit , um festzustellen, was genau die Anwendung oder Website tun muss . Im Falle einer Web-Anwendung , beinhaltet die Planung bestimmen, welche Anwender-Tasks wird das Projekt zu erleichtern. Im Falle einer Website bestimmt die Planung , welche Inhalte die Website für die Nutzer, sowie alle Prozesse braucht es für die Umsetzung zu präsentieren.
Entwurf
Programmierung Sprachen wie PHP ermöglichen es Entwicklern, aus einer Reihe von Design-Methoden wählen . In einigen Fällen müssen Projekte nicht um eine formale Methodik , aber es ist immer eine Option. PHP -Anwendungen können Objektorientierte Entwicklung, in der Anwendung Aufgaben sind bis zu einer Gruppe von Objekten Anwendung unterteilt. Jedes Objekt hat einen bestimmten Satz von Verantwortlichkeiten innerhalb der Anwendung , mit den Objekten , die in Verbindung , um die volle Funktionalität innerhalb des Projekts liefern . Die Planung für ein PHP-Projekt kann es sich um die Entscheidung über die Klassen und Objekte , die die Anwendung Verarbeitung liefern.
Umsetzung
Die Implementierungsphase eines PHP Projekt ist, wenn die meisten der Programmierung passiert. Entwickler beginnen von allen Design-Dokumente in früheren Stadien erstellt und diese als Basis für ihre Aktivitäten Codierung . Wenn ein Team von Entwicklern auf einer einzigen PHP-Anwendung funktioniert, kann jeder Programmierer verantwortlich für einen gesonderten Bereich der Verarbeitung. Die Implementierungsphase beinhaltet das Schreiben von PHP-Code und führt es zur Durchführung von grundlegenden Tests . Implementierung in einer objektorientierten PHP Projekt wird die Schaffung Klassendeklarationen , wobei jede Klasse einen gut definierten Satz von Eigenschaften und Verhalten.
Testing
Sobald die wichtigsten Umsetzungsphase abgeschlossen ist Entwickler oft Eingriff in einer Test . In dieser Phase laufen Entwicklern die PHP-Anwendung oder Website , die Durchführung einer strengen Reihe von Aufgaben entwickelt, um alle Probleme zu identifizieren. Wenn Probleme auftreten , wird ein Prozess der Fehlersuche auch stattfinden, mit Programmierern machen Ergänzungen oder Änderungen bestehender Code während der Implementierungsphase erstellt .
Lieferung
Wenn Entwickler vervollständigen die Umsetzung und Testphase eines PHP-Projekt , können sie dann die endgültige Anwendung bereitstellen Produkt . In vielen Fällen arbeiten Entwicklungsteams auf Webseiten und Anwendungen, die auf internen Servern , bevor Sie die endgültigen Versionen auf Client- Server live gehen im Web. In einigen Fällen kann die Lieferung Phase kann durch laufende Wartungsarbeiten auf lange Sicht verfolgt werden.